News

If we get more comprehensive theory about programming expertise, it will lead to better methods for learning and teaching computer programming," Kubo says.
Computer programming involves knowing how to write code—a handy skill for a variety of technology jobs. In everything from creating websites to developing software programs, strong computer ...
How to Become a Computer Programmer Many computer programmers begin as self-taught enthusiasts and a persistent interest in programming can be an asset in your career because continued learning is ...
Formal methods offer a mathematically rigorous framework for the specification, development and verification of programming languages and software systems. By leveraging techniques such as theorem ...
Programming for Computer Graphics An introduction to the programming principles, methods and techniques of computer graphics. The course covers general graphics methods and techniques, graphics ...
This course introduces students to the fundamentals of computer programming as students design, write, and debug computer programs using the programming language Python and R. The course will also ...